Output 9887262b132285386d8c9ad6ed192fa1a01a31eb69abc444b3165a277ad41d04:0

value
344656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862be857bbcc83248dd1b0b577c0d19d26c90904 OP_EQUAL
address
3DvT514EL4ZM9cdi4LFd1UniXG4Dbn2u5b
transaction
9887262b132285386d8c9ad6ed192fa1a01a31eb69abc444b3165a277ad41d04
spent
true